Output 91babc5eda368465d01ea4077527b5b0ca7c19901835f2825481ef64d2f182cb:14

value
12291
script pubkey
OP_0 OP_PUSHBYTES_20 cf8dc41ed7df7ee2c1d50fba92de1a4caf7431a6
address
bc1qe7xug8khmalw9sw4p7af9hs6fjhhgvdxjttg4k
transaction
91babc5eda368465d01ea4077527b5b0ca7c19901835f2825481ef64d2f182cb
spent
true